PROFESSIONAL INSTALLATION GUIDE – CRITICAL FOR NO LEAKS:

  1. CLEAN THREADS: Remove all dirt, oil, and old sealant from both the adapter's threads and the threads of the port you're installing it into.

  2. APPLY SEALANT:

    • PTFE Tape: Wrap the MALE threads 4-6 times clockwise (looking from the end of the fitting). Do not cover the first thread. For fuel/oil, use PTFE tape rated for hydrocarbons (often yellow or pink).

    • Liquid/Paste Sealant: Apply a moderate amount to the male threads. Use a sealant compatible with your fluid (e.g., Loctite 545, Permatex High-Temp Thread Sealant).

  3. INSTALLATION: First, screw the MALE end of this elbow into your engine block, oil filter sandwich plate, or remote mount. Tighten firmly using a wrench—typically 1.5 to 2 turns past finger-tight for NPT. Do not overtighten, as this can crack aluminum housings.

  4. SECOND CONNECTION: Once the elbow is securely installed, apply sealant to your sensor or gauge's male threads and screw it into the FEMALE end of this elbow. Tighten snugly.

  5. PRESSURE TEST: After installation and before full operation, start the engine and carefully check for leaks at both connections. Re-tighten slightly if necessary.
